Coach Ken Woods discusses leadership qualities

Coach Woods has over 20 years of experience as a Life Coach and Motivational Speaker in initiating and leading major community organizations, and over two decades of hands-on work with young adults. He has provided motivational talks; trainings; and resources to aid in the effort of empowering youth and giving them hope for a brighter future. He is a retired educator of 17 years; known and respected as a leader in providing mentoring; counseling; and life coaching services to students, professional athletes and corporate executives.

Coach is the Life Coach for the Atlanta Celtics Basketball Program and to date, they have sent 30 players to the NBA and 4 players to the NFL. Website: www.atlantaceltics.org. Also he is the Community Outreach Consultant to the Georgia Commission on the Holocaust.  Website: www.holocaust.georgia.gov.
